> Hi Tadziu,
>
> > I can confirm the bug.  But it's not mm.tmac that has changed,
> > so it must be something in troff itself (somewhere between
> > versions 1.21 and 1.22.2).
>
> Well, if I've done it right, `git bisect' is saying it went wrong with
>
> http://git.savannah.gnu.org/cgit/groff.git/commit?id=d32e328afb82eff0ddd85943b0f8813377a8ccf4
> which *is* m.tmac.
>
>     Wed Jan 5 15:05:47 2011 Werner LEMBERG <address@hidden>
>
>         Fix use of .DEVTAG-* macros.
>         Reported by Anton Shepelev <address@hidden>.
>
>         * m.tmac (address@hidden): Wrapper around .DEVTAG-* to compensate
> unwanted
>         vertical space.
>         (H): Use it.
>
> But I haven't investigated further.  However, it does provide a single
> version to make it easier to confirm if it causes the problem.
